About Me: Gerald Steele was born in Winnipeg, Manitoba, Canada. He received his first guitar, a classical, when he was 9. He took guitar lessons every Saturday morning for a couple of years, travelling alone by bus from St Norbert to downtown Winnipeg with his guitar. He used to sleep with his red portable radio under his pillow, falling asleep to the top tunes of the 60's. His mom was an avid music lover and played her 45's on the big TV/Stereo unit in the livingroom. When Gerald turned 11, he enrolled in Navy League Cadets, then Sea Cadets.
